Hi Guys,
I just bought a Rain Bird ST600O and I am ready to install it.
First I have to remove the old one which is the one in the attached image.
My question is, do you know if I can twist the nut just below the old timer (1 on the image)?
I tried and it doesn't come off.
Or do I need to remove everything from #2 up?
Thanks a lot.

You'll have to open that junction box up, disconnect the wires since there are junctions in there, and disconnect that conduit connector nut below. That transformer has a threaded spud this was screwed together with those fittings and the bell box before the assembly was mounted. Removing it will have to be the reverse of installing. Think backwards!

If there is room to spin the transformer inside the enclosure, then you won't need to take things apart. It doesn't look like that is possible but pictures have no depth rendition.

Be sure to turn off the breaker first!
